To everyone’s surprise, the two actors have just announced in a hilarious video that Wolverine will face Wade Wilson in Deadpool 3, still in the guise of his iconic interpreter. As Hugh Jackman had said goodbye to the character in Logan, one wonders what scenario pirouette they will find to introduce him into the Marvel Cinematic Universe, while mutants are still almost non-existent there. By the way, Kevin Feige and Marvel Studios have confirmed the release of Deadpool 3 for September 6, 2024. The third film on the bloody adventures of Wade Wilson is therefore added to an already busy 2024 schedule for the MCU, where Captain America: New World Order (May 3), Thunderbolts (July 26), and Fantastic Four (November 6), which will open Phase VI. Barring a surprise with the reboot of Blade carried by Mahershala Ali and expected in November 2023, Deadpool 3 should be the first Rated R movie of the MCU, in the vein of the first two. We also learn that Shawn Levy (Stranger Things, Free Guy) will be in charge of the production, while screenwriters Rhett Reese and Paul Wernick will be back to write this third opus. As a reminder, Ryan Reynolds and Hugh Jackman had already shared the appear together in the movie X-Men Origins: Wolverine, with a very cheap version of Deadpool. If Wade Wilson settled his account in person in the post-credits scenes of Deadpool 2, we hope for a dantesque confrontation between him and the mutant with adamantium claws.
